  • The Spotter - OSHA Safety Manuals
    The Spotter With the high level of material delivery on a construction project and with delivery trucks generally required to back on the site, it becomes very important for the safety of workers and the project to provide spotters

  • Recordkeeping - Overview - Occupational Safety and Health Administration
    Electronic Submission of Records OSHA collects work-related injury and illness data from establishments through the Injury Tracking Application (ITA) Establishments that meet certain size and industry criteria are required to electronically submit injury and illness data from their OSHA Form 300A, 300, and 301 (or equivalent forms) once per year to OSHA
